Я использую ILSpy для изучения сборок. Теперь у меня есть задача найти все методы в исследуемой сборке, которые зависят от сторонней сборки. Другими словами, я хочу знать, какие методы в моих методах вызова сборки в сторонней сборке. Возможно ли каким-то образом использовать ILSpy или другое программное обеспечение?Найти все методы, зависящие от сторонней библиотеки
ответ
Я не знаю, инструмент, который автоматизирует зависит от анализа.
Если сборка сторонних производителей достаточно мала, вы можете загрузить ее и исследованную сборку и использовать функцию «Поиск использования» JustDecompile для всех типов сборки и начать с нее. Исследуемая сборка также должна иметь управляемый размер.
Вы также можете автоматизировать его, но вам придется написать код для этого. Оба механизма JustDecompile и ILSpy имеют открытый исходный код. Вы можете создать плагин, который сделает это.
Последнее, но не менее важное: вы можете повысить это значение - https://justdecompile.uservoice.com/forums/113277-justdecompile-feature-suggestions/suggestions/1772437-provide-depends-on-analysis, чтобы эта функция увеличивалась на отставание JustDecompile.
- 1. Методы, зависящие от модуля тестирования
- 2. Как проверить зависящие от времени методы?
- 3. Как отделить пух от сторонней библиотеки?
- 4. зависимость от сторонней библиотеки по всей системе
- 5. Отладка сигнала SIGPIPE от сторонней библиотеки
- 6. Минимизировать зависимость от другой сторонней библиотеки
- 7. ios скрыть предупреждение от сторонней рамки/библиотеки
- 8. Запись библиотеки, которая необязательно зависит от сторонней библиотеки
- 9. Импорт сторонней библиотеки
- 10. Использование сторонней библиотеки (sbpl)
- 11. Андроид сторонней библиотеки
- 12. Использование сторонней библиотеки
- 13. Можно ли найти объекты, зависящие от синонима?
- 14. Добавить методы в класс сторонней библиотеки в Python
- 15. Файлы, зависящие от версии
- 16. Файлы, зависящие от источника
- 17. Свойства, зависящие от решения
- 18. Проекты, зависящие от Visual Studio
- 19. Существуют ли в Ruby методы, не зависящие от класса?
- 20. Scala: как добавить зависящие от типа методы в признаке?
- 21. Развертывание сторонней библиотеки в perforce
- 22. Обновление сторонней библиотеки с Cocoapods
- 23. Использование сторонней библиотеки с maven
- 24. Зависимость сторонней библиотеки WiX CustomAction
- 25. Android Studio: приложение в зависимости от источников сторонней библиотеки
- 26. PythonAnywhere + virtualenv: «Не удалось найти библиотеки, зависящие от платформы <exec_prefix> ...»
- 27. Где я могу найти источник сторонней библиотеки в Android Studio?
- 28. Условия, зависящие от времени
- 29. Для сторонней библиотеки требуется 32-разрядное приложение?
- 30. Как найти инструкцию от сторонней общей библиотеки, вызвавшей сбои в работе андроида?